Страница 1 из 2

Не поступают get запросы

Добавлено: Пн июл 02, 2018 2:10 pm
VGor
Добрый день. Прошу помощи в такой ситуации: на МД данные поступают от Ардуино с модулем w5100. До вчерашнего дня все работало. Вчера get запросы, посылаемые Ардуино, перестали приниматься МД. Причем если я этот же запрос вбивают в строку браузера, все отрабатывает. МД на малине. И малина и контроллеры (3 штуки) в сети видны друг другу. Запросы, отправленные с малины на контроллеры, отрабатываются нормально. Подскажите, куда копать?

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 2:24 pm
serghei
То есть вчера работало , а сегодня нет и не было никаких обновлений ?
На апельсине похожая ситуация - с WIFI модулей данные не проходят , хотя на винде все в порядке. С проводными ардуинами проблем нет. В линуксе есть команда вывода в сериал последней строчки лога апача. Узнаю - напишу. Она покажет - пробиваются запросы до Алисы или нет.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 2:30 pm
VGor
Со светом только электрики почти сутки баловались. То включали, то отключали. С очень малыми временными интервалами. А так ничего не обновлял. Самое странное, что со всех трёх контроллеров не проходит.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 2:34 pm
serghei
Если баловались со светом , то что то поломалось. У меня сразу после установки не взлетело. Самому интересно разобраться.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 3:16 pm
VGor
Так попробовать?
tail -f /var/log/apache2

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 3:46 pm
serghei
Очень похоже. До своей доберусь только ночью.

PS/ В линуксе я вообще никак ((. Поставил пакет

Код: Выделить всё

#  sudo apt-get install multitail
Но не могу сообразить какую команду дать для вывода лога.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 9:08 pm
VGor
Посмотрел. В логе апача запросы есть. Синтаксис с запросами, поступающими через браузер, одинаковый. Через браузер свойство меняется, через запрос от контроллера нет. Уже и не знаю, что смотреть...
127.0.1.1:80 192.168.0.100 - - [02/Jul/2018:21:02:32 +0300] "GET /objects/?object=Relay3&op=m&m=switch&status=0 HTTP/1.1" 200 205 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:61.0) Gecko/20100101 Firefox/61.0"
1 Это через браузер, все отработало
127.0.1.1:80 192.168.0.111 - - [02/Jul/2018:21:05:59 +0300] "GET /objects/?object=Relay3&op=m&m=switch&status=1 HTTP/1.1" 400 0 "-" "-"
Это от контроллера, проигнорировано.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 9:13 pm
VGor
Единственно, после самого запроса, через браузер 200 205 (есть разные цифры, но нти разу 0), а от контроллеров всегда 400 0. Что значат эти цифры?

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 9:28 pm
serghei
Это коды ошибок HTTP . Подробнее надо смотреть Тут. Как с ними драться я не знаю.

Re: Не поступают get запросы

Добавлено: Пн июл 02, 2018 9:42 pm
VGor
Спасибо. Синтаксическая ошибка. Буду думать.